Material Performance in the Gulf Climate
Kuwait’s climate—among the harshest in the Gulf, with extreme summer heat and frequent dust—demands materials engineered for performance. Kuwait Precision specifications use UV-stable finishes, corrosion-protected hardware, and furniture construction rated for decades of service in air-conditioned environments. Our planning coordinates with building systems to maintain comfort and air quality, ensuring that executive environments remain pristine and productive through the region’s most demanding seasons.
